RESOLUTION OF TH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F PALO ALTO
EXPRESSING APPRECIATION TO GEORGE ZIMMERMAN
UPON HIS RETIREMENT
WHEREAS, George Zimmerman served the City of Palo Alto as
a member of the Department of Planning and Community Environment
from October 1965 through June 1994; and
WHEREAS, George Zimmerman began as an Assistant Planner
and, during his tenure with the City of Palo Alto, has been
promoted several times to his current position of Assistant
Planning Official; and
WHEREAS, George Zimmerman pursued his 29 -year career with
exceptional dedication and concern for the City of Palo Alto and
its citizens; and
WHEREAS, George Zimmerman's significant personal
contributions have been made in the interest of guiding the
development of the community while striving to maintain a high
degree of professionalism; and
WHEREAS, George Zimmerman served as staff liaison to the
Historic Resources Board and was instrumental in the preparation of
the 1976 Comprehensive Plan, the 1978 Zoning Ordinance, the 1980
Comprehensive Plan update, the 1986 Downtown Study, the Downtown
Amenities Study, the 1989 Citywide Land. Use and Transportation
Study, the Urban Design Guide, and the 1995 Comprehensive Plan; and
WHEREAS, the City of Palo Alto wishes to acknowledge and
thank George Zimmerman for his personal commitment to and pride in
the community and his significant personal efforts and substantial
dedication as a team member of the Department of Planning and
Community Environment.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that the City Council of
the City of Palo Alto hereby commends the outstanding public
service of George Zimmerman and records its appreciation, as well
as the appreciation of the citizens of this community, upon the
occasion of his retirement.
INTRODUCED AND PASSED: June 20, 1994
